People Score in 02859, Pascoag, Rhode Island

The People Score for the Asthma Score in 02859, Pascoag, Rhode Island is 49 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

An estimate of 90.73 percent of the residents in 02859 has some form of health insurance. 21.85 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 79.22 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.

A resident in 02859 would have to travel an average of 11.35 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Landmark Medical Center. In a 20-mile radius, there are 4,531 healthcare providers accessible to residents living in 02859, Pascoag, Rhode Island.

**Where We Live: The Impact of Housing and Environment**

The very homes we inhabit can play a significant role in asthma management. Older homes, common in Pascoag, can harbor hidden triggers: mold, dust mites, and pests. These allergens can exacerbate asthma symptoms, leading to increased medication use, emergency room visits, and a diminished quality of life.
